The STIMESI-2 project enhances Microsystems design education in European universities by providing hands-on training and access to design tools and technologies. It focuses on developing skilled engineers for the industry through practical courses and collaboration with MEMS foundries.
This proposal is submitted to maintain and further increase the Microsystems design activities in European Universities and Research Institutes which has arisen since the start of the successful courses created and offered during the current STIMESI project due to end in December 2009.The goal of the STIMESI-2 project is similar but more focused than that of the current STIMESI.
